IMPORTANT NOTES: Portugal features diverse terrain, including regions with steep streets and uneven surfaces. Please bring sturdy walking shoes with good grips for the cobblestone walkways, and be prepared for a lot of walking.


LUGGAGE: In Portugal, elevators in train stations or other public places are rare. We use public transport on this trip, meaning you will need to carry your luggage from platform to platform, in and out of trains and buses, etc., and possibly up several flights of stairs. You will also need to be able to stow your luggage safely on trains and buses. Therefore, you must pack light and bring luggage that is compact, lightweight, and easy to transport.

ABOUT OUR TRANSPORTATION: Walking, bus, boat, train, and private vehicle.
Intercity transport on this trip will be mainly by public bus and train. The bus and train systems in Portugal are generally very good, most offer seat reservations, some buses have toilet facilities and others don't, but drivers often stop en route for service station breaks.


Please note that we use public transport such as metro and taxis to get to train and bus stations. It is essential that you can carry your luggage comfortably and that it can be packed into a relatively small space. Between transport and hotels, you may be required to carry your luggage short distances (up to 15 mins walk), occasionally the group will take taxis to and from hotels.
